Madden NFL 17 will be added to the EA Access games vault on February 24, EA has announced.

Given a new Madden game isn’t likely to launch until August, this means EA Access members get around six months with the latest entry in the series before being tempted by the 18 edition.

Madden NFL 17 joins a growing list of available games in the EA Access vault, including Star Wars Battlefront, Battlefield 4, Dragon Age Inquisition, Need For Speed and many more.

EA also announced three new additions to the PC sister service, Origin Access. Aragami, Furi, and The Saboteur are all now available from the Origin Access vault.

Both EA Access and Origin Access are priced £3.99 a month, or the considerably cheaper £19.99 for a year option.
